We’re really excited to share with you a new feature we’re trying out on Talk. ‘Infinite scroll’ is used in other places on the web, and typically makes it faster and easier to read long pieces of content. We’ve built a very basic test on this thread only that demonstrates how infinite scroll Talk would work in your mobile browser (you won’t find this on desktop, for now).
Why are we trying infinite scroll?
Many of you have indicated that it’s much easier to read threads continuously, when you don’t have to select ‘Next’ to keep on reading and infinite scroll should make reading threads more natural. Also, if we can make infinite scroll work, we should be able to make pages load a lot faster for you -- hurrah!
Super-important caveats
This is not a complete feature, which means it currently doesn’t let you jump to the end of the thread, remember your place on a thread, bookmark or do a number of other things you’d usually expect a Talk thread to do usually. The performance will also be slower and you might find some bugs. This is because we want to get your thoughts before we put more work into it.
